using System.Text.RegularExpressions;
using Microsoft.Extensions.Configuration;
using ZB.MOM.WW.Secrets.Abstractions;
namespace ZB.MOM.WW.Secrets.Configuration;
/// <summary>
/// Expands <c>${secret:name}</c> reference tokens in configuration values by resolving each
/// referenced secret through an <see cref="ISecretResolver"/>. Expansion is <em>fail-closed</em>:
/// a token that names an absent secret throws <see cref="SecretNotFoundException"/> rather than
/// leaving the placeholder (or a blank) in place, so a misconfigured deployment fails loudly at
/// startup instead of silently running with an empty credential.
/// </summary>
public sealed class SecretReferenceExpander
{
private const string TokenMarker = "${secret:";
private static readonly Regex TokenPattern = new(@"\$\{secret:([^}]+)\}", RegexOptions.Compiled);
private readonly ISecretResolver _resolver;
/// <summary>Creates an expander that resolves references via <paramref name="resolver"/>.</summary>
/// <param name="resolver">The resolver used to fetch each referenced secret's plaintext.</param>
public SecretReferenceExpander(ISecretResolver resolver) =>
_resolver = resolver ?? throw new ArgumentNullException(nameof(resolver));
/// <summary>
/// Replaces every <c>${secret:name}</c> token in <paramref name="raw"/> with the resolved
/// plaintext of the named secret. Multiple tokens (including repeats of the same name) are all
/// expanded; each distinct name is resolved once.
/// </summary>
/// <param name="raw">The raw configuration value, possibly containing reference tokens.</param>
/// <param name="ct">A token to cancel the operation.</param>
/// <returns>
/// The expanded value, or <paramref name="raw"/> unchanged when it is <c>null</c> or contains
/// no tokens.
/// </returns>
/// <exception cref="SecretNotFoundException">A referenced secret does not exist (fail-closed).</exception>
public async Task<string> ExpandAsync(string raw, CancellationToken ct)
{
if (raw is null)
{
return raw!;
}
MatchCollection matches = TokenPattern.Matches(raw);
if (matches.Count == 0)
{
return raw;
}
// Resolve each distinct referenced name exactly once, then substitute synchronously.
var resolved = new Dictionary<string, string>(StringComparer.Ordinal);
foreach (Match match in matches)
{
string name = match.Groups[1].Value.Trim();
if (resolved.ContainsKey(name))
{
continue;
}
string? value = await _resolver.GetAsync(new SecretName(name), ct).ConfigureAwait(false);
if (value is null)
{
throw new SecretNotFoundException(
$"Configuration references unknown secret '{name}' via ${{secret:{name}}}.");
}
resolved[name] = value;
}
return TokenPattern.Replace(raw, m => resolved[m.Groups[1].Value.Trim()]);
}
/// <summary>
/// Walks every entry in <paramref name="config"/> and rewrites, in place, any value that
/// contains a <c>${secret:...}</c> token to its expanded plaintext. Writes go through the
/// <see cref="IConfigurationRoot"/> indexer so subsequent reads — and any options binding done
/// afterward — observe the expanded values.
/// </summary>
/// <remarks>
/// This MUST run <em>after</em> configuration is loaded and <em>before</em> options validation
/// or <c>ValidateOnStart</c> executes; otherwise validators may see the unexpanded placeholder.
/// Fail-closed: a missing referenced secret propagates <see cref="SecretNotFoundException"/> out
/// of startup.
/// </remarks>
/// <param name="config">The loaded configuration root to mutate.</param>
/// <param name="ct">A token to cancel the operation.</param>
/// <exception cref="SecretNotFoundException">A referenced secret does not exist (fail-closed).</exception>
public async Task ExpandConfigurationAsync(IConfigurationRoot config, CancellationToken ct)
{
ArgumentNullException.ThrowIfNull(config);
// Materialize first: mutating provider data while enumerating AsEnumerable() is unsafe.
var pending = new List<KeyValuePair<string, string>>();
foreach (KeyValuePair<string, string?> entry in config.AsEnumerable())
{
if (entry.Value is { } value && value.Contains(TokenMarker, StringComparison.Ordinal))
{
pending.Add(new KeyValuePair<string, string>(entry.Key, value));
}
}
foreach (KeyValuePair<string, string> entry in pending)
{
config[entry.Key] = await ExpandAsync(entry.Value, ct).ConfigureAwait(false);
}
}
}

using Microsoft.Extensions.Configuration;
using ZB.MOM.WW.Secrets.Abstractions;
using ZB.MOM.WW.Secrets.Configuration;
namespace ZB.MOM.WW.Secrets.Tests.Configuration;
public sealed class SecretReferenceExpanderTests
{
private sealed class FakeSecretResolver : ISecretResolver
{
private readonly Dictionary<string, string?> _values;
public FakeSecretResolver(Dictionary<string, string?> values) => _values = values;
public Task<string?> GetAsync(SecretName name, CancellationToken ct) =>
Task.FromResult(_values.TryGetValue(name.Value, out string? v) ? v : null);
}
private static SecretReferenceExpander Expander(params (string Name, string? Value)[] secrets)
{
var dict = new Dictionary<string, string?>();
foreach ((string name, string? value) in secrets)
{
dict[new SecretName(name).Value] = value;
}
return new SecretReferenceExpander(new FakeSecretResolver(dict));
}
[Fact]
public async Task ExpandAsync_SingleToken()
{
SecretReferenceExpander expander = Expander(("sql/foo", "hunter2"));
string result = await expander.ExpandAsync("Password=${secret:sql/foo}", CancellationToken.None);
Assert.Equal("Password=hunter2", result);
}
[Fact]
public async Task ExpandAsync_MultipleTokens()
{
SecretReferenceExpander expander = Expander(("sql/foo", "hunter2"), ("sql/bar", "swordfish"));
string result = await expander.ExpandAsync(
"u=${secret:sql/foo};p=${secret:sql/bar}", CancellationToken.None);
Assert.Equal("u=hunter2;p=swordfish", result);
}
[Fact]
public async Task ExpandAsync_NoToken_Unchanged()
{
SecretReferenceExpander expander = Expander(("sql/foo", "hunter2"));
string result = await expander.ExpandAsync("no tokens here", CancellationToken.None);
Assert.Equal("no tokens here", result);
}
[Fact]
public async Task ExpandAsync_MissingSecret_Throws()
{
SecretReferenceExpander expander = Expander();
SecretNotFoundException ex = await Assert.ThrowsAsync<SecretNotFoundException>(
() => expander.ExpandAsync("Password=${secret:sql/absent}", CancellationToken.None));
Assert.Contains("sql/absent", ex.Message);
Assert.Contains("${secret:sql/absent}", ex.Message);
}
[Fact]
public async Task ExpandConfigurationAsync_RewritesMatchingKeys()
{
SecretReferenceExpander expander = Expander(("sql/foo", "hunter2"));
IConfigurationRoot config = new ConfigurationBuilder()
.AddInMemoryCollection(new Dictionary<string, string?>
{
["ConnectionStrings:Db"] = "Server=.;Password=${secret:sql/foo}",
["Plain:Value"] = "unchanged",
})
.Build();
await expander.ExpandConfigurationAsync(config, CancellationToken.None);
Assert.Contains("hunter2", config["ConnectionStrings:Db"]);
Assert.DoesNotContain("${secret:", config["ConnectionStrings:Db"]);
Assert.Equal("unchanged", config["Plain:Value"]);
}
[Fact]
public async Task ExpandConfigurationAsync_MissingSecret_FailsClosed()
{
SecretReferenceExpander expander = Expander();
IConfigurationRoot config = new ConfigurationBuilder()
.AddInMemoryCollection(new Dictionary<string, string?>
{
["ConnectionStrings:Db"] = "Server=.;Password=${secret:sql/absent}",
})
.Build();
await Assert.ThrowsAsync<SecretNotFoundException>(
() => expander.ExpandConfigurationAsync(config, CancellationToken.None));
}
}
